    Question: why did you close down the aperture as opposed to raising the shutter speed?

    • @RyanTroy
      @RyanTroy 3 ปีที่แล้ว +1

      Right?! Aperture controls depth of field and even strobes not ambient light. I think she could of done better this was probably just a rushed video so she was able to not miss her upload date.

    • @floralacan2865
      @floralacan2865 3 ปีที่แล้ว +13

      I feel like Jessica doesn’t really like shooting wide open. She often use the background in her shots, the textures or the landscape.

    • @RyanTroy
      @RyanTroy 3 ปีที่แล้ว +1

      @@floralacan2865 Im just trying to teach her a few things to take her photography to the next level

    • @alstuart8801
      @alstuart8801 3 ปีที่แล้ว +1

      yeah , id have gone for the faster shutter

    • @hasanbarzak9356
      @hasanbarzak9356 3 ปีที่แล้ว +30

      @@RyanTroy it’s a creative choice, not an accident. She’s been a photographer for over 10 years she definitely knows how to control light with aperture vs shutter speed. Like she said multiple times in the video about shooting harsh day light, many shooters shy away from it but she finds a way to make great images in harsh light with closed off apertures. It’s far from the typical mold of golden hour wide open and more photographers should try to test themselves in unconventional environments like this

    i don’t get why she just doesn’t make her aperture like a F2.8 or F4 and just increase her shutter speed to like 1/1000th of a second

    • @stephengatley8144
      @stephengatley8144 3 ปีที่แล้ว +13

      It kinda depends on the lens you are using as to wether you shoot 1.4, 2, 2.8, 4 most older lenses resolve the image better at 2 stops up from wide open. It's an old rule from when lenses were not as sharp as current lenses, but there are exceptions to the rule!.

    • @RyanTroy
      @RyanTroy 3 ปีที่แล้ว +4

      you are 100 percent correct

    • @err7273
      @err7273 3 ปีที่แล้ว +7

      @@stephengatley8144 true, but i don’t think people are gonna pixel peep every photo that’s why it doesn’t make sense for modern photography
